About company

With a focus on trust, transparency, and community ties, this crowdfunding platform facilitates impactful global giving while maintaining a hyperlocal approach. Its mission centers on showcasing the boundless opportunities available to anyone through its platform. By leveraging the power of crowdfunding, individuals can make a tangible difference in communities around the world, fostering connections and enabling meaningful change. The platform prioritizes accessibility, allowing users to engage in philanthropy regardless of their geographical location or financial capacity. Through a blend of technology and community-driven initiatives, it seeks to empower individuals to contribute to positive social and environmental outcomes on a global scale.

Key Details:

  • Location: The company is headquartered in Palo Alto, California, United States.
  • Founders: Fundly.com was founded by Erik Nilsson and James Nicol.
  • Foundation Date: The company was established in the year 2010.

We used Fundly for our school's fundraisers.
by Lindsay

We used Fundly for our school's fundraisers. Overall, it was quick to set up and made accepting donations from out-of-town families easy. It was better than cookie dough and chocolate fundraisers. We organized a walkathon and asked parents to spread the word. Many used Facebook to get relatives to donate through Fundly. Some brought cash or checks, too. My only wish was to upload videos into emails. But Fundly made raising money easy. We'll use them for our Fall Back to School Fundraiser too.

My interaction with Fundly and Stripe has been utterly distressing and unacceptable
by Brandon

My interaction with Fundly and Stripe has been utterly distressing and unacceptable. After initiating a fundraiser and contributing $1,000 to my cause, Stripe promptly disabled my payment account, leaving me unable to receive donations. Despite persistent attempts to seek clarification, their responses were evasive and lacked transparency. They cited a vague "elevated risk of dispute charges" without providing concrete evidence or specifics. Moreover, while they refunded payments from other donors, they inexplicably withheld my own $1,000 contribution. Initially, they assured me of a brief 5-7 day hold on my funds, but this period extended outrageously to 120 days, causing significant financial distress and reputational damage. This experience reeks of incompetence, dishonesty, and a lack of accountability. It not only undermined my fundraising efforts but also jeopardized my trust in these platforms. I urge others to exercise caution when using Fundly and Stripe, as their actions border on fraudulent and unethical behavior.
